K-Tec Collaborates with SSAB to Pilot Fossil-free Steel

K-Tec has entered an agreement with SSAB, to become the first original equipment manufacturer of heavy-duty earth scrapers to pilot SSAB Fossil-free™️ steel in its earthmoving product line.

Part of the K.A. Group, K-Tec takes the first step toward eliminating carbon emissions by focusing on material selection. As a fossil-free partner to SSAB, K-Tec will have access to pilot deliveries of SSAB Fossil-free™️ steel, which has virtually zero carbon dioxide emissions from the steelmaking process. The steel initially will be used in K-Tec’s key products serving the construction and mining industries.

This collaborative initiative is K-Tec’s next step in reducing emissions and improving sustainability for its customers. The company already designs, manufactures and delivers strong, lightweight earthmoving equipment built with SSAB’s Hardox® wear steel and Strenx® performance steel brands.

The massive advantage of K-Tec scrapers is using lightweight, strong steel, so that contractors can haul more material, instead of heavy iron. Additionally, K-Tec’s high-capacity scrapers allow for greater production requiring less cycles per day to shrink the earthmoving carbon footprint compared to traditional methods of earthmoving.

“This partnership demonstrates the commitment from both companies toward reducing carbon emissions,” says Johnny Sjöström, Head of Special Steels at SSAB. “Our transformation to change the way steel is made is well underway, and we are proud to already have reached this far in our journey towards a fossil-free future.”

As a market leader in premium steels, SSAB plans to revolutionize the entire steelmaking process by producing steel with virtually zero carbon dioxide emissions. The pilot deliveries of SSAB Fossil-free™️ steel are made using the unique HYBRIT-technology, which was jointly developed by SSAB, iron ore producer LKAB and energy company Vattenfall. It replaces the coking coal traditionally used for iron ore-based steelmaking with fossil-free electricity and green hydrogen. The by-product is water instead of carbon dioxide emissions.
